Ruling coalition holding meeting at Singha Durbar



KATHMANDU: The ruling coalition is holding a meeting to discuss the latest political developments.

A meeting of the coalition is being held at Singha Durbar before the parliamentary meeting Wednesday afternoon, a source said.

The ruling coalition includes the Nepali Congress, the CPN-Maoist Center, the Janata Samajwadi Party and the Rastriya Janamorcha.

The CPN-Unified Socialist Party led by Madhav Kumar Nepal is yet to join the government.
